protected void BindSILO() { Controls objControls = new Controls(); SiloBl objSiloBl = new SiloBl(); var objResult = objSiloBl.Silo_SelectAll(); if (objResult != null) { if (objResult.ResultDt.Rows.Count > 0) { objControls.BindDropDown_ListBox(objResult.ResultDt, ddlSILONo, "Name", "PLCValue"); } ddlSILONo.Items.Insert(0, new System.Web.UI.WebControls.ListItem("--Select All--", "-1")); } }
private void BindgvSilo() { try { SiloBl objReceptionBl = new SiloBl(); var objResult = objReceptionBl.Silo_SelectAll(); if (objResult != null) { gvSilo.DataSource = objResult.ResultDt; gvSilo.DataBind(); PanelVisibilityMode(true, false); } } catch (Exception ex) { throw ex; } }
protected void gvSilo_OnRowCommand(object sender, GridViewCommandEventArgs e) { try { SiloBl objSiloBL = new SiloBl(); if (e.CommandName == "Edit1") { ViewState["Mode"] = "Edit"; ViewState["ID"] = e.CommandArgument.ToString(); var objResult = objSiloBL.Silo_Select(Convert.ToInt32(ViewState["ID"].ToString())); if (objResult != null) { if (objResult.ResultDt.Rows.Count > 0) { txtName.Text = objResult.ResultDt.Rows[0][SiloBo.SILO_NAME].ToString(); txtPLCValue.Text = objResult.ResultDt.Rows[0][SiloBo.SILO_PLCVALUE].ToString(); PanelVisibilityMode(false, true); } } } else if (e.CommandName == "Delete1") { var objResult = objSiloBL.Silo_Delete(Convert.ToInt32(e.CommandArgument.ToString()), Convert.ToInt32(Session[ApplicationSession.Userid].ToString()), System.DateTime.UtcNow.AddHours(5.5).ToString()); if (objResult.Status == ApplicationResult.CommonStatusType.Success) { ClientScript.RegisterStartupScript(typeof(Page), "MessagePopUp", "<script>alert('Record Deleted Successfully.');</script>"); PanelVisibilityMode(true, false); BindgvSilo(); } else { ClientScript.RegisterStartupScript(typeof(Page), "MessagePopUp", "<script>alert('You can not delete this Reception because it is in used.');</script>"); } } } catch (Exception ex) { log.Error("Error", ex); ClientScript.RegisterStartupScript(typeof(Page), "MessagePopUp", "<script>alert('Oops! There is some technical Problem. Contact to your Administrator.');</script>"); } }
private void BindSiloId() { ApplicationResult objResult = new ApplicationResult(); objResult = new SiloBl().Silo_SelectAll_MilkAnalysis(); if (objResult != null) { if (objResult.ResultDt.Rows.Count > 0) { Controls objControls = new Controls(); objControls.BindDropDown_ListBox(objResult.ResultDt, ddlSiloId, "Name", "ID"); } else { ClientScript.RegisterStartupScript(typeof(Page), "MessagePopUp", "<script>return alert('Please Add SILO Id First.');</script>"); } ddlSiloId.Items.Insert(0, new System.Web.UI.WebControls.ListItem("- None -", "-1")); ddlSiloId.SelectedIndex = 1; } }
protected void btnSave_OnClick(object sender, EventArgs e) { try { SiloBo objSiloBo = new SiloBo(); SiloBl objSiloBl = new SiloBl(); objSiloBo.Name = txtName.Text.Trim(); objSiloBo.PLCValue = Convert.ToInt32(txtPLCValue.Text); if (ViewState["Mode"].ToString() == "Save") { objSiloBo.CreatedBy = Convert.ToInt32(Session[ApplicationSession.Userid]); objSiloBo.CreatedDate = DateTime.UtcNow.AddHours(5.5); var objResult = objSiloBl.Silo_Insert(objSiloBo); if (objResult != null) { if (objResult.ResultDt.Rows.Count > 0) { int intStatus = Convert.ToInt32(objResult.ResultDt.Rows[0]["Status"].ToString()); if (intStatus == 0) { ClientScript.RegisterStartupScript(typeof(Page), "MessagePopUp", "<script>alert('" + txtName.Text + " is already exist.');</script>"); } else { ClientScript.RegisterStartupScript(typeof(Page), "MessagePopUp", "<script>alert('Record Saved Successfully.');</script>"); ClearAll(); BindgvSilo(); PanelVisibilityMode(true, false); } } } } else if (ViewState["Mode"].ToString() == "Edit") { objSiloBo.LastModifiedBy = Convert.ToInt32(Session[ApplicationSession.Userid]); objSiloBo.LastModifiedDate = DateTime.UtcNow.AddHours(5.5); objSiloBo.SILOID = Convert.ToInt32(ViewState["ID"].ToString()); var objResult = objSiloBl.Silo_Update(objSiloBo); if (objResult != null) { if (objResult.ResultDt.Rows.Count > 0) { int intStatus = Convert.ToInt32(objResult.ResultDt.Rows[0]["Status"].ToString()); if (intStatus == 0) { ClientScript.RegisterStartupScript(typeof(Page), "MessagePopUp", "<script>alert('" + txtName.Text + " is already exist.');</script>"); } else { ClientScript.RegisterStartupScript(typeof(Page), "MessagePopUp", "<script>alert('Record Updated Successfully.');</script>"); ClearAll(); BindgvSilo(); PanelVisibilityMode(true, false); } } } } } catch (Exception ex) { log.Error("Error", ex); ClientScript.RegisterStartupScript(typeof(Page), "MessagePopUp", "<script>alert('Oops! There is some technical Problem. Contact to your Administrator.');</script>"); } }